Chance Sparks: 5-stars for an imperfect stay, because a nice hotel has to be judged by how they respond. We had a major plumbing issue well out of their control involving some kind of broke line. Maintenance was there within 5 minutes, and they had us moved to a new room with keys and a luggage cart within another 5 minutes, along with some credits. That is a level of quality response you just don’t see often, and they should be commended!

Knut Böhmer: Had a great two-night stay here for a conference. The front-desk staff was helpful and friendly. Tameka informed me that the room I booked was located on top of the elevator, and immediately offered to switch rooms for a very reasonable $5 upgrade per night - much appreciated!The room itself was clean and had everything I needed for two days. I was initially a bit concerned about road noise, but that turned out to be not a problem.The hotel is within easy reach of several hotels that were used for conference receptions, as well as restaurants, and the convention center is literally around the corner.Definitely a good place to stay for a reasonable price!

Nick Kilstein: This is a perfectly adequate hotel for the location and price. The service, parking, and breakfast are all good. The pool and hot tub are very nice. The only downside is that the rooms are a bit old and the showers are especially dated. No matter how hard I tried, I could not get the curtains to prevent water from getting all over the bathroom.

Oksana K: Love coming here! The decor and the atmosphere are so elegant and you can tell before you even get to the front desk that they put in effort here. The staff has always been exactly what you hope for when you’re staying in a hotel; super helpful and very friendly no matter who is working. The rooms are clean and have what you need, we love the poolside room for ease of accessing the pool and sauna and hot tub. Love that they added a ping pong table too! I like that they have full size shampoo and conditioner and body wash in the showers so I don’t have to bring my own or bug housekeeping for a million of the little bottles, and my hair feels so soft after their products! The cookies and milk at night give me and my kids a fun little activity to do before bed. We have to come to Minneapolis a lot for doctor appointments and I always check if they have rooms available first, their parking is convenient compared to other hotels I’ve stayed in downtown and it’s right down the street from the clinic and hospital. Coming from a small town of less than 500 people Minneapolis can be kind of scary sometimes but I felt completely safe when I came here all alone last year with my baby, it feels secure and quiet and you know the staff is attentive.
